In the study of truth-conditional semantics, the relationship between two propositions can be defined by the notion of entailment. Consider the following sentences:1. Julian managed to renovate the old Victorian mansion.2. Julian renovated the old Victorian mansion.Based on the semantic properties of the verb "manage", it is correct to assert that:
- ASentence 1 presupposes sentence 2, meaning that if 2 is false, 1 has no truth value.
- BSentence 1 unilaterally entails sentence 2, as the truth of 1 guarantees the truth of 2 due to the lexical semantics of "manage".
- CSentences 1 and 2 are in a relation of mutual entailment (paraphrase), since "manage" is a semantically empty auxiliary in this context.
- DSentence 1 and 2 present a conversational implicature, where the effort implied in 1 can be cancelled without affecting the truth of 2.
